A NEPALESE GILT-BRONZE FIGURE OF PADMAPANI.
19th Century.
Cast in several joined parts, standing in tribhanga, his left hand in virtaka mudra, the right turned downwards in varada mudra, wearing an ankle-long skirt decorated with dragons and blossoms and elaborate jewellery, his hair arranged in a tall bun with traces of cold painting, raised on a double lotus pedestal, 88cm H, 12kg.
